Output 6afbde64d8ed20d96a7ca8c707c70485a715a0933abaea085741080b5cc2882e:0

value
1573327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90411d9b59b753b3ab383e4cab9e19a90a7ae35f OP_EQUAL
address
3EqmEUv9KRNzDaon6sqRT9MdkEZxwefLWn
transaction
6afbde64d8ed20d96a7ca8c707c70485a715a0933abaea085741080b5cc2882e
spent
true